Facebook Founders is World’s Youngest Billionaires

Forbes brought out they’re annual list of the world’s billionaires during Monday — there is 1,426 of them on the planet — and noticed that there is merely 23 below 40. And Facebook’s founders is the youngest on the list.

Dustin Moskovitz and Mark Zuckerberg founded Facebook way back up in the day. At present, at the tender age of 28, the pair are the youngest billionaires on Forbes list, with net worths of $3.8 billion and $13.3 billion respectively, according to the website.

Eduardo Saverin, who as well co-founded the website, represents 5th youngest at 30 and worth $2.2 billion, accordant to Forbes. In 2012, Saverin renounced his United States. citizenship, an move wide thought to be a way approximately capital gains tax — something Saverin refused by his spokesman.

Bringing together it in the list of the 5 youngest billionaires is Scott Duncan, who came into the the massive fortune late energy pipeline entrepreneur Dan Duncan, and Albert von Thurn und Taxis, who also inherited a vast wealth.
